Lukaku wants to visit Eriksen in hospital: “But no place for pity on the field” | European Football Championship 2020

The Devils are already training tonight in the stadium where Eriksen fell a few days ago. “That does help,” Lukaku said before training. “But I try to put it behind me. My head is now on the match, we have to continue.”

Lukaku knows Eriksen from Inter. “I have already sent him a message and he has let us know that he is okay. I have already asked the coach if I could visit him in the hospital, we will see if that is possible. But now he has to get time with his family to rehabilitate.”

“We have prepared something with the group tomorrow. In the 10th minute we will kick the ball outside and applaud. That is our support. That is the most normal thing in the world because we have several players in the group who know him personally. “

“But tomorrow we will also be here to win, that remains the most important task. There is no room for pity at this level.”

“It will certainly not be an easy match”, Lukaku knows. “Denmark is a really good team and they now have an extra motivation. We certainly do not underestimate them. This will be a good test.”

According to Lukaku, it is good news that Kevin De Bruyne, Axel Witsel and Eden Hazard are fit. “It is important that we can grow to our type team. I am happy that they are there and hope that they get minutes and that we win as a team.”

“Now that everyone is back, we need to build momentum and grow to our best form.”
